About Swift Aircraft Management LLC
Swift Aircraft Management LLC is a FAA Part 135 certified charter operator with a fleet of 8 aircraft including 3 very light jet, 1 light, 1 heavy, 3 turboprop. The fleet has an average age of 15.5 years, with the newest aircraft manufactured in 2018. 8 of 8 aircraft hold valid FAA registrations (100%). The operator has a clean NTSB safety record with no reported incidents.

Fleet (8 aircraft)
| Tail Number | Type | Category | Year |
|---|---|---|---|
| N337CM | Citation Mustang | Very Light Jet | 2011 |
| N428JE | CitationJet CJ3 | Light | 2018 |
| N60XG | HondaJet | Very Light Jet | 2017 |
| N709BA | Challenger 605 | Heavy | 2009 |
| N728LM | PC-12 NG | Turboprop | 2006 |
| N786WM | PC-12 NG | Turboprop | 2007 |
| N873PC | PC-12 NG | Turboprop | 2007 |
| N88CH | Citation Mustang | Very Light Jet | 2009 |
